On Thu, Apr 30, 2015 at 10:09 AM, Warner Losh <[email protected]> wrote:
> No PCMICA card can do DMA. Cardbus can, but there=E2=80=99s no DMA define=
d
> in the PCMICA =E2=80=9Cr2=E2=80=9D standard that defines 16-bit PC Cards.=
 The CF form
> factor in the Z50 is just the PC Card form, not the true IDE form. So you
> are out of luck if you want a DMA storage option on this card.

Wasn't so much about wanting a DMA based storage option.  Just that
the TruIDE microdrives are much cheaper than the Memory style
drives.....
